How much do live in summer j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 15, 2026, the average hourly pay for live in summer in Boston, MA is $17.26,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.62 and $19.09 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a live-in summer nanny,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Live-In Summer Nanny, you need experience in childcare, first aid/CPR certification, and often a valid driver’s license. Familiarity with child development tools, safety protocols, and scheduling or communication apps is typically required. Strong soft skills include patience, adaptability, and excellent communication to build trust and effectively interact with children and parents. These skills ensure a safe, nurturing, and engaging environment for children during the summer months.

What are some typical responsibilities and challenges for a live-in summer camp counselor?

As a live-in summer camp counselor, you’ll be responsible for supervising campers, leading activities, ensuring safety, and fostering a positive, inclusive environment. One common challenge is managing long hours while maintaining enthusiasm and energy, as you’re often on call around the clock. Teamwork is essential, as counselors work closely with other staff to plan events, resolve conflicts, and support campers’ well-being. This role offers valuable leadership experience and the chance to build strong relationships with both campers and colleagues.

What is a live in summer?

A Live In Summer job typically refers to a seasonal position where an employee resides at their place of work for the duration of the summer. These roles are often found at summer camps, resorts, or as au pairs, where room and board are provided in addition to compensation. Employees are expected to be available for extended hours and may take on responsibilities such as supervising children, leading activities, or assisting with daily operations. These jobs offer valuable experience, opportunities for networking, and a unique chance to live and work in new environments during the summer months.

Live In Summer jobs generally involve living with a family or in seasonal accommodations, focusing on personal assistance or household tasks. Live In Summer Camp Counselors specifically work at camps, supervising children and leading activities. While both roles require background checks and seasonal commitment, camp counselors often need additional certifications like CPR. The main difference lies in the work environment and responsibilities, with camp counselors working in outdoor settings and engaging in youth supervision.
